Studies show that 34% of mentally ill people complain of toothache, 30% suffer from swollen or bleeding gums, and 25% complain of pain and dry mouth when chewing or swallowing. Pointing out that oral and dental health problems trigger psychological problems by bringing about a lack of self-confidence, Romaniando Founder Ossama Çetinkaya said, “The effort to do oral and dental care at home in the most professional way possible is increasing in order not to see the dentist except in cases of necessity.”

According to a study conducted by the CareQuest Oral Health Institute in America, one in five people say their mental health is moderate or poor. Of these people, 34% appear to complain of toothache, 30% of swollen or bleeding gums, and 25% of pain and dry mouth when chewing or swallowing. While experts drew attention to the fact that the increased mental problems, especially in the pandemic, reduced the attention paid to personal care, Ossama Çetinkaya, the founder of the cosmetic brand Romaniando, also pointed out that oral and dental health problems lead to a lack of self-confidence. Çetinkaya said, “The mouth and teeth are the starting point of not only nutrition but also communication. However, inadequate care can have consequences that lower people's self-confidence, such as yellowed teeth or bad breath. This leads to hesitation and introversion from being involved in social life.”

Professional oral and dental care at home is becoming widespread

Mentioning that psychological problems such as anxiety and panic attacks triggered in the pandemic reduce dentist visits, Ossama Çetinkaya said, “Research shows that 47% of people who define their mental health as bad are nervous during their visits to the dentist. Of course, it is possible to say that the risk of contamination during the epidemic also triggers concerns. What we have observed as Romaniando is that the effort to do oral and dental care at home in the most professional way possible has increased in order not to see the dentist except in obligatory situations. As a matter of fact, the use of cosmetic products in the oral and dental care category is becoming more and more common.
